Output 903cadaa2658f7443e9af91f2354ed87909933486dec7eb557e3ef06cf6b6867:0

value
53144500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ec9267a4bc4e2ed036346ab25dde08414b48822a OP_EQUAL
address
MVU366Azc5qEfL9VC3UZ9eM5RruptaZyiW
transaction
903cadaa2658f7443e9af91f2354ed87909933486dec7eb557e3ef06cf6b6867
spent
true